2024年5月9日发(作者:)
sqlite 变量定义
SQLite变量定义
SQLite是一种轻量级的关系型数据库管理系统,它具有快速、可靠、
易于使用的特点。在SQLite中,变量的定义和使用是非常重要的,
它们可以用于存储和操作数据,提高代码的可读性和可维护性。本
文将介绍SQLite中变量的定义和使用方法。
一、变量的定义
在SQLite中,可以使用关键字"DECLARE"来定义变量。变量可以
是整数、实数、字符串等类型,具体的类型由变量所存储的数据类
型决定。下面是一些常见的变量定义示例:
1. 声明整型变量:
```
DECLARE @num INT;
```
2. 声明实数变量:
```
DECLARE @price REAL;
```
3. 声明字符串变量:
```
DECLARE @name TEXT;
```
二、变量的赋值
定义变量之后,可以使用"SET"关键字来给变量赋值。下面是一些常
见的变量赋值示例:
1. 给整型变量赋值:
```
SET @num = 10;
```
2. 给实数变量赋值:
```
SET @price = 3.99;
```
3. 给字符串变量赋值:
```
SET @name = 'SQLite';
```
三、变量的使用
在SQLite中,可以使用定义的变量进行计算、比较和存储等操作。
下面是一些常见的变量使用示例:
1. 使用变量进行计算:
```
DECLARE @x INT;
DECLARE @y INT;
SET @x = 5;
SET @y = 3;
SELECT @x + @y;
```
2. 使用变量进行比较:
```
DECLARE @age INT;
SET @age = 18;
SELECT * FROM users WHERE age > @age;
```
3. 使用变量进行存储:
```
DECLARE @result TEXT;
SET @result = 'Success';
INSERT INTO logs (message) VALUES (@result);
```
四、变量的作用域
在SQLite中,变量的作用域是指变量的可见范围。一般情况下,变
量的作用域是在定义它的代码块内部。例如,在一个存储过程或触
发器中定义的变量只在该存储过程或触发器内部可见,外部代码无
法访问。
五、变量的命名规则
在SQLite中,变量的命名需要遵循一定的规则。下面是一些常用的
命名规则:
1. 变量名只能包含字母、数字和下划线;
2. 变量名不能以数字开头;
3. 变量名对大小写不敏感;
4. 变量名不能与关键字相同;
六、总结
本文介绍了SQLite中变量的定义和使用方法。通过合理使用变量,
可以提高代码的可读性和可维护性,使程序更加灵活和高效。在实
际开发中,我们应该根据具体需求来合理使用变量,并遵循变量的
命名规则,以提升代码质量和开发效率。希望本文对您理解SQLite
变量的定义和使用有所帮助。
发布者:admin,转转请注明出处:http://www.yc00.com/news/1715246760a2588549.html
评论列表(0条)